Output 039ae66db2be0da620ba6ee2dfd6d90a44e1cd0565df6e4b8d48c0652e0d6531:4

value
626375080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735d4de855597997b21588cc78ca2db696be1c5d OP_EQUAL
address
3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om
transaction
039ae66db2be0da620ba6ee2dfd6d90a44e1cd0565df6e4b8d48c0652e0d6531
confirmations
462456
spent
true